Glamorous Rooms showcases the elegant eclecticism of renowned designer Jan Showers's interiors, including many projects unpublished until now. design, which seamlessly blend Hollywood high style, mid-century modernism and classic 18th century French style.
Hardcover, 208 pages
Published September 1st 2009 by Abrams (first published 2009)

Everything's big - and shiny - in Texas. I can appreciate why people might like these interiors, filled as they are with certain kinds of "tasteful" status symbols while remaining livable. To me, they're static, staid and too predictably cluttered and arranged.
